Dancehall newcomer Plazmic is continuing to build his burgeoning career with the release of his latest single, “Well Off.”
Blending dancehall, trap dancehall, and Caribbean urban influences, the track showcases the Montego Bay native's signature mix of raw street energy, melodic flows, and authentic storytelling.
Known for tracks such as “Immortal,” “Big Cheque,” “Pressa” featuring dancehall artiste Squash, and “Express,” Plazmic has steadily built momentum as one of the emerging names in Jamaica’s new wave of dancehall and a rising talent from his hometown community.
His music often explores themes of ambition, resilience, loyalty, and survival, resonating with listeners both in Jamaica and across international markets.
Backed by his management team, Sultan Entertainment Collective, which also produced the track, Plazmic continues to expand his reach through strategic releases, collaborations, and performances. With “Well Off,” the artiste delivers another energetic offering while staying true to his mantra: “Real stories. Real energy. Real dancehall.”
